I Love it! September 17, 2005 I love my zv45340us notebook - I even bought 3 so other members of my family could have their own. I purchased refurbished ones for $1030 each several months ago and have not had any problems. Awesome notebook, love the wireless network feature that I use at home, and I use it to watch DVD's on plane trips and travel. Primarily bought it to use for school, but has turned out to be great for entertainment use while traveling. Bought power supply for use in car (must be 150w at least to power it), and found a saddlebag (must be for widescreen notebook) that is perfect to take on the go. I must admit though it is a little heavy for me to lug around but not enough for me to leave it at home when traveling!
Great desktop replacement. December 13, 2004 I got this laptop on a tradein at Best Buy because my eMachines M6805 had a manufacturing defect. This laptop is better in almost every aspect. The ultrabright screen is very clear and bright. The hard drive is only 4200 rpm, but its size makes up for this. It is very sturdy and should last a while for anyone who takes care of it. The Geforce 440 Go graphics card is probably the weakest part of this system, but it still has 64 MB of dedicated memory. I have not tried the DVD burner yet, and I am wondering what speed it burns at (couldn't find this information anywhere)... Also, it may be tough to find a carrying case that will hold this machine. Overall I recommend this laptop to anyone needing a portable powerhouse.
